The Rise of AI in Stock Content
Defining AI Stock Content Creation
AI stock content creation involves using artificial intelligence algorithms to automatically generate various types of media assets suitable for stock platforms. These assets can include:
- Images: Photographs, illustrations, and graphics.
- Videos: Short clips, animated sequences, and explainer videos.
- Audio: Music tracks, sound effects, and voiceovers.
The AI leverages vast datasets and machine learning techniques to understand patterns, replicate styles, and produce original content that meets specific requirements. The goal is to create stock assets that are visually appealing, technically sound, and commercially viable.

Overcoming Challenges in AI Stock Content Creation
Ensuring Originality and Avoiding Copyright Issues
One of the primary challenges is ensuring that AI-generated content is truly original and does not infringe on existing copyrights. AI models are trained on vast datasets, which may include copyrighted material.
- Solution: Using AI models that are specifically designed to generate original content, and employing techniques such as adversarial training to minimize the risk of copying existing styles or patterns. Additionally, businesses should perform due diligence to ensure that the generated content does not violate any copyright laws.
Maintaining Quality and Relevance
AI-generated content is not always perfect. It may require editing and refinement to ensure that it meets quality standards and is relevant to the target audience.
- Solution: Implementing human oversight in the content creation process. This involves having human editors review and refine AI-generated content to ensure that it is accurate, visually appealing, and aligned with the brand’s messaging.
Dealing with Bias in AI-Generated Content
AI models can inherit biases from the data they are trained on, leading to skewed or unfair representations in the generated content.
- Solution: Using diverse and representative datasets to train AI models, and implementing bias detection and mitigation techniques to identify and correct any biases in the generated content. This can involve using fairness metrics to evaluate the output of AI models and adjusting the training data to address any disparities.

Examples of AI Tools for Stock Content Creation
Image Generation Tools
- DALL-E 2: Creates realistic images and art from natural language descriptions.
Example: Generate an image of “a cat wearing a space helmet in a futuristic city.”
- Midjourney: A powerful AI image generator known for its artistic and surreal creations.
Example: Create a photorealistic image of “a serene forest at sunset with ethereal lighting.”
- Stable Diffusion: An open-source AI model that can generate high-quality images from text prompts.
Example: Generate an image of “a cyberpunk cityscape with neon lights and flying cars.”
Video Generation Tools
- Synthesia: Creates AI avatars that can deliver video presentations in multiple languages.
Example: Create a video tutorial of how to use a specific software with an AI avatar presenting the information.
- RunwayML: Offers a suite of AI tools for video editing, including object removal, style transfer, and motion tracking.
Example: Remove unwanted objects from a video clip or apply a specific artistic style to a video sequence.
- Pictory: A video creation tool that uses AI to turn text content into engaging videos.
Example: Turn a blog post into a short video summary with relevant visuals and voiceover.
Audio Generation Tools
- Amper Music: Generates custom music tracks based on user preferences and parameters.
Example: Create a background music track for a podcast episode with a specific mood and tempo.
- Jukebox (OpenAI): An AI model that generates music with vocals in various styles.
Example: Generate a pop song with a catchy melody and lyrics about summer.
- Resemble AI: Creates realistic AI voices for voiceovers and audio content.
Example: Generate a voiceover for a marketing video with a specific accent and tone.
